Appendix E.2.1.
Example:
Add a parameter to the Modbus client side Map Descriptor called Data_Type.
If you specify the Data_Type as Single_Register and the Function as WRBC or WRBX, then a Modbus poll with FC 6
will be generated.
Logically Single Register implies a length of one, and even if you try to set the length longer in the csv file, the
length is limited to 1 in the driver.

Appendix E.3. Read/write Operation

When using the driver as a Modbus master, the function RDBC allows read/write capability with Register and Coil
data types. If defaults are used, then Function codes 5 and 6 (Single Writes) are used to write data back to the
registers being read, regardless of data length being read. If multiple writes (FC 15 and 16) are needed for
Read/write operation, the user needs to specify the Node_Type parameter in the Client Side Nodes Section and set
it to Block_Mode.
Note that block writes of length 1 are currently all that is supported.
